Cape Fiolent is situated at 8.5 km to the south of Balaklava. The Bajocian volcano-sedimentary sequence is composed of interbedding rock masses represented by lavas of sodium basalts, basaltic andesites, microdiabases, acidic tuffs with interlayers of rhyolites, felsites, andesitic dacites, andesites, andesites porphyrites and tuffs of basic composition.
